Set the Mood with Lighting

Lighting plays a crucial role in creating that serene spa ambiance. Here’s how to make it work for your bathroom:

Choose Soft, Adjustable Lighting

Start by replacing harsh overhead lights with softer, warmer alternatives. Consider installing dimmable fixtures or adding a warm, decorative lamp to the space. The goal is to create a mellow glow that invites relaxation rather than one that feels clinical. You could also use candles to add an element of ambiance, which leads us to our next point.

Incorporate Candles

Candles are not just for romantic dinners; they are perfect for creating a soothing atmosphere in your bathroom. Choose scented candles that promote relaxationβ€”like lavender or eucalyptus. To elevate the experience, light them when you’re taking a bath or enjoying some quiet time. Just be sure to place them safely away from water!

Indulge Your Senses with Scents

A great spa experience always involves delightful scents that calm the mind and invigorate the senses. Here’s how to incorporate aromatic elements:

Essential Oils and Diffusers

Investing in a good quality diffuser can transform the aroma in your bathroom. Essential oils like chamomile, bergamot, and peppermint can create a serene atmosphere. Add a few drops to your diffuser, and you’ll find yourself enveloped in a peaceful, fragrant cocoon.

Herbs and Botanicals

Add a touch of nature with potted herbs or dried botanicals. Plants like lavender, mint, and rosemary are not only beautiful but also release delightful scents when brushed against. A small vase with fresh flowers can also brighten the space and add a lovely smell.

Upgrade Textures and Fabrics

The textures in your bathroom are vital in creating that spa-like retreat. Soft towels, plush rugs, and elegant accessories can elevate your space significantly. Here’s how to choose the right ones:

Luxurious Towels

Invest in high-quality, plush towels that feel amazing against your skin. Look for options made from 100% cotton or bamboo for that extra softness. If you really want to up the ante, consider adding a heated towel rack. Imagine stepping out of the shower and wrapping yourself in a cozy, warm towelβ€”bliss!

Soft Bath Mats

Complement your flooring with a plush bath mat. Select one that is absorbent and soft, providing a comfortable experience for your feet after a shower or bath. Choose calming colors like soft grey or muted pastel shades for that tranquil vibe.

Create a Relaxing Soundscape

Sound can dramatically affect your mood, so consider how to enhance the auditory experience in your bathroom:

Nature Sounds

Using a Bluetooth speaker, listen to calming nature sounds while you soak in the tub. The sound of trickling water or gentle rain can evoke a refreshing outdoor experience, elevating your bath ritual.

Relaxing Music

Alternatively, create a playlist filled with spa music or soft instrumental tracks. Just be mindful of keeping the volume lowβ€”after all, this is your sanctuary for relaxation.

Optimize for Comfort

Comfort is a significant aspect of any spa-like environment. It’s essential to make your space accommodating and cozy.

Temperature Control

Ensure that the temperature in your bathroom is just right. You don’t want to be shivering after a warm bath! Use a space heater if needed to elevate the warmth, making sure you also keep a comfortable towel rack nearby to hold onto your heated towels.

Declutter for Zen

Remove any clutter from surfaces; a clean and organized bathroom can immediately feel more peaceful. Use baskets or stylish storage solutions to keep items hidden away. The more streamlined the design, the more tranquil your space will feel.

Accessorize Thoughtfully

Choose accessories that complement the overall feel of a spa. The right decor can tie everything together!

Minimalist Decor

Limit decorations to a few carefully chosen itemsβ€”such as a beautiful mirror, a piece of artwork, or minimalistic shelf decor. A clutter-free space brings a sense of calm, allowing your mind to rest easier.

Natural Elements

Add wooden elements or stones to enhance that earthy feel often found in spas. A wooden stool or stone tray can be both functional and aesthetically pleasing.

Personalize Your Experience

Finally, remember that your comfort is key in crafting your spa-like haven. Tailor the space to suit your personal preferences:

Keep a Journal or Book

Incorporate reading material for your downtimeβ€”whether it’s a journal to jot down thoughts or a good book. Make sure they’re water-resistant if you plan to keep them in the bathroom!

Plan DIY Spa Treatments

Prepare for a spa day at home. Keep some DIY face masks, scrubs, and bath bombs ready to go. Treat yourself and your skin with at-home rituals that transform your bathroom into a luxurious escape.
